Hyoid bone location is between the chin and the cartilage of the thyroid gland at the level of the third or fourth cervical vertebra. …
Webhyoid bone, U-shaped bone situated at the root of the tongue in the front of the neck and between the lower jaw and the largest cartilage of the larynx, or voice box. The primary function of the hyoid bone is to serve as an … WebThe hyoid bone is important to a number of physiological functions, including breathing, swallowing and speech. It is also thought to play a key role in keeping the upper airway …
